The 2019 Premier Escalante is a 34-foot triple-tube pontoon with twin 250-horsepower Honda engines capable of reaching 52 mph and cruising at 28 mph. The aluminum hull accommodates up to 24 passengers across a double-deck layout featuring an upper level with staircase access and a built-in slide. The design emphasizes stability through an oversized saltwater center pontoon, allowing confident handling in 2- to 3-foot seas and wake crossings.
The boat includes a full galley with an electric pump sink, an enclosed restroom with holding tank, and expansive seating throughout both decks. Navigation and fish-finding capabilities come from a Simrad GPS and fish finder. Entertainment is supported by an upgraded sound system with amplifier and 10-inch subwoofer, while a rear camera aids docking maneuvers.
The Escalante planes quickly even with a full passenger load and maintains smooth cruising characteristics across a range of water conditions.
